About Kui Jiang
Kui Jiang is a scholar working on Molecular Biology, Gastroenterology, Epidemiology, Cancer Research and Surgery, having authored 37 papers that have together received 1.4k indexed citations. Recurring topics across this work include Gut microbiota and health (12 papers), Gastrointestinal motility and disorders (7 papers), Cancer-related molecular mechanisms research (5 papers), Heme Oxygenase-1 and Carbon Monoxide (4 papers), Ferroptosis and cancer prognosis (3 papers), Liver Diseases and Immunity (3 papers), MicroRNA in disease regulation (3 papers) and Autophagy in Disease and Therapy (3 papers). The work is most often cited by research in Gastroenterology (262 citations), Biological Psychiatry (49 citations), Cancer Research (195 citations), Molecular Biology (734 citations) and Pharmacy (34 citations). Kui Jiang has collaborated with scholars based in China, United States and Portugal. Frequent co-authors include Hailong Cao, Bangmao Wang, Yue Sun, Bangmao Wang, Li Lü, Tianyu Liu, Wenxiao Dong, Tianming Zhao, Xiaofei Fan and Mengque Xu. Their work appears in journals such as Pharmacological Research, Medicine, Food & Function, Scientific Reports and Cancer Letters.
